What Is a Touchless Infrared Forehead Thermometer?

A non-contact infrared thermometer measures infrared energy emitted from the forehead and converts that information into a temperature reading.

Because the thermometer does not need to touch the skin during normal use, it can provide a more hygienic approach when checking several family members.

The U.S. Food and Drug Administration notes that non-contact infrared thermometers can reduce the need for contact and help reduce certain cleaning requirements between measurements when they are used correctly.

This makes a digital forehead thermometer useful for homes, childcare situations, workplaces, clinics, and other environments where convenient temperature monitoring is important.

Hygienic No-Contact Temperature Monitoring

When illness spreads through a household, minimizing unnecessary shared contact can be useful.

A no-touch forehead thermometer helps reduce direct skin contact during temperature measurement. This makes it particularly practical for families with several children or caregivers monitoring more than one person.

However, touchless does not mean maintenance-free. The FDA recommends keeping the thermometer’s sensing area clean and dry and avoiding touching the sensor.

Following the product’s cleaning and storage instructions can help maintain reliable performance.

How to Use an Infrared Forehead Thermometer Correctly

Correct positioning matters when using an infrared thermometer.

The FDA advises holding the sensing area perpendicular to the forehead and keeping the person still during measurement. The correct distance between the thermometer and forehead varies by device, so users should follow the manufacturer’s instructions rather than assuming one distance works for every model.

Environmental conditions may also affect measurements, so the instructions supplied with the thermometer should be followed carefully.

For the most useful results, take readings consistently and avoid treating a single measurement as a complete medical assessment.

What Does FSA/HSA Eligible Mean?

Some thermometers and diagnostic devices may qualify as medical expenses under U.S. FSA or HSA rules. IRS guidance states that qualifying medical expenses can include equipment, supplies, and diagnostic devices used for medical care.

If a particular thermometer is advertised as FSA/HSA eligible, shoppers should still confirm eligibility with their FSA/HSA administrator or plan provider before purchasing, because reimbursement requirements can vary.

Important Accuracy Considerations

A medical infrared thermometer should always be used according to its instructions.

The FDA has reported that performance can vary between non-contact infrared thermometer models, and some tested devices have shown limitations when used to determine whether a person has crossed a specific fever threshold.

If a temperature reading seems inconsistent with how someone feels, repeat the measurement according to the instructions and consider confirming it with another appropriate thermometer or contacting a healthcare professional when needed.
